The Science Behind Stubborn Carpet Stains

Understanding why certain stains resist conventional cleaning methods helps explain the necessity of professional treatment:

Molecular Bonding: Many staining substances create chemical bonds with carpet fibers, becoming part of the fiber structure rather than simply residing on the surface.

Dye Transfer: Colored substances containing chromophores can permanently alter carpet coloration through dye transfer, particularly with natural fibers.

Heat Setting: When stains experience heat—from sunlight, foot traffic, or improper spot cleaning attempts—molecular changes occur that make removal significantly more challenging.

Oxidation: Some stains, particularly those from organic sources, undergo oxidation processes that create permanent color changes when exposed to oxygen over time.

pH Factors: Highly acidic or alkaline substances can damage carpet fiber structures, creating permanent discoloration beyond simple staining.

Penetration Depth: Liquid stains can penetrate beyond carpet fibers into backing materials and underpad, creating reservoirs that continuously wick back to the surface during conventional cleaning.

Common Stubborn Stains Requiring Professional Treatment

Several stain types present particular challenges for conventional cleaning approaches:

Red Wine and Fruit Juices: Contain natural dyes and tannins that quickly bond with carpet fibers, especially in wool and nylon carpeting.

Pet Accidents: Beyond visible stains, urine penetrates deeply into carpet padding, creating persistent odors and attracting bacteria while potentially damaging fiber backing through alkaline degradation.

Coffee and Tea: Contain tannins that bond strongly with carpet fibers while creating stubborn discoloration that worsens with oxidation over time.

Oil-Based Stains: Cooking oils, cosmetics, and automotive fluids create hydrophobic barriers that repel water-based cleaning attempts while attracting additional soiling.

Blood and Protein Stains: Coagulate and bond with fibers, becoming increasingly complex to remove as they oxidize and set within carpet structures.

Unknown Combination Stains: Many real-world carpet stains involve multiple substances that require specialized identification and targeted treatment protocols beyond the capabilities of consumers.

Professional Carpet Cleaning Technologies

Advanced cleaning methods employed by professionals deliver superior results:

Hot Water Extraction: Often called steam cleaning, although it actually uses hot water rather than steam, this method injects heated cleaning solution into the carpet fibers under pressure, then immediately extracts it along with dissolved contaminants. The combination of heat, chemical action, and powerful extraction removes deeply embedded materials beyond the reach of conventional methods.

Encapsulation Cleaning: Specialized polymeric cleaners surround soil particles with crystalline structures that isolate contaminants, prevent resoiling, and facilitate removal through standard vacuuming. Particularly effective for maintenance cleaning in commercial environments.

Dry Compound Cleaning: Pre-moistened absorbent compounds containing detergents and solvents break down stubborn stains while binding with soil particles, then remove them through mechanical agitation and thorough vacuuming.

Bonnet Cleaning: Rotating absorbent pads, combined with specialized cleaning solutions, provide effective surface cleaning for lightly soiled carpets, although without the deep extraction capabilities of other methods.

Carbonation Cleaning: Millions of microscopic carbonated bubbles penetrate carpet fibers, breaking apart soil particles and lifting them to the surface for extraction without excessive moisture.

Two-Phase Protectant Application: After thorough cleaning, professional-grade protectants create molecular shields around carpet fibers, preventing future staining by blocking dye transfer and repelling liquids before they can penetrate.

The Professional Stain Removal Process

Expert carpet cleaners follow systematic procedures for optimal results:

Stain Assessment: Proper identification of stain type through visual inspection and pH testing determines the appropriate treatment protocol.

Pre-Treatment: Application of specialized pre-conditioners based on specific stain composition breaks down stubborn materials and prepares them for extraction.

Dwell Time: Allowing appropriate time for cleaning agents to penetrate stains and break molecular bonds without excessive moisture exposure that could damage the backing.

Temperature Control: Utilizing precise heat levels that enhance cleaning efficacy without setting stains or damaging delicate fibers.

Agitation: Controlled mechanical action works cleaning agents into carpet fibers without causing texture damage or fiber distortion.

Multiple-Pass Extraction: Professional equipment with powerful vacuum systems makes several passes over treated areas, removing maximum contamination without over-wetting.

Neutralization: Application of pH-balancing rinses prevents residue buildup and fiber damage while creating conditions inhospitable to future bacterial growth.

Targeted Spot Treatments: Specialized solutions for particularly stubborn stains based on specific chemical composition rather than one-size-fits-all approaches.

Selecting Professional Carpet Cleaning Services

Quality carpet cleaning providers demonstrate several distinguishing characteristics:

Certification: Technicians should hold certification from recognized organizations such as the Institute of Inspection, Cleaning, and Restoration Certification (IICRC).

Specialized Equipment: Commercial-grade machines with superior heat, pressure, and extraction capabilities deliver more thorough cleaning than consumer-level alternatives.

Pre-Inspection Protocols: Professional services conduct thorough examinations of carpet type, construction, stains, and special concerns before beginning work.

Testing Procedures: Quality providers perform inconspicuous spot testing to verify colorfastness and appropriate chemical compatibility before full application.

Multiple Cleaning Options: Reputable companies offer various cleaning methods tailored to specific carpet types, conditions, and soiling levels, rather than a single approach for all situations.
